Released in 2018, LOVE is a drama film directed by Alexander Zeldin, running about 60 minutes.

What it’s about. In the communal area of a block of temporary accommodation, the residents go about their day-to-day routines in the run-up to Christmas. The bonds of love that keep people together are put to the test.

Who’s in it. LOVE stars Anna Calder-Marshall as Barbara, Nick Holder as Colin, Luke Clarke as Dean and Janet Etuk as Emma, among others.
